When purchasing a treadmill that folds, you should consider the dimensions of the deck and the highest speed it is able to attain. The treadmill will cost more if its top speed is greater, but you will receive an improved workout. The motor is essential because it determines the strength of the treadmill. Most people can power walk and run at speeds of between 2 and 5mph. If you are planning to run frequently, a greater top speed is needed.

When selecting a treadmill with a folding design be aware of two things such as the motor as well as the size of the deck. A bigger deck is more comfortable for walking or jogging, and can accommodate heavier people. For a more serious runner, you'll require a motor that's 2.5 horsepower or more.

In addition to the motor, a quality treadmill will have a strong frame and ergonomically designed handlebar. A good warranty will cover these features and may include replacement parts at no cost for the duration of the treadmill. It is also recommended to select a warranty which includes labor costs since repairs can be expensive.
